( 2008-04-27) John Adams is a 2008 American television miniseries chronicling U.S. Founding Father and president John Adams 's political life and his role in the founding of the United States. The miniseries was directed by Tom Hooper and starred Paul Giamatti in the title role.

  4. Há 3 dias · Constantine Alexander Payne (born February 10, 1961) is an American film director, screenwriter and producer. He is noted for his satirical depictions of contemporary American society. Payne has received numerous accolades , including two Academy Awards , a BAFTA Award and two Golden Globe Awards as well as a nomination for a Grammy Award .
